Coupler-Assisted Leakage Reduction for Scalable Quantum Error Correction with Superconducting Qubits
Superconducting qubits are a promising platform for building fault-tolerant quantum computers, with recent achievement showing the suppression of logical error with increasing code size. However, leakage into noncomputational states, a common issue in practical quantum systems including superconducting circuits, introduces correlated errors that undermine quantum error correction (QEC) scalability.
